intel AnyPoint DSL Gateway (Model 1400) Default Router Login: Username, Password & IP Address

FieldValue
Router ModelAnyPoint DSL Gateway (Model 1400)
BrandIntel
Default IP Address192.168.0.254
Login URLhttp://192.168.0.254
Default Usernameadmin
Default Passwordadmin
Wireless StandardNot specified
Frequency BandsNot specified
Quick Answer: To log in to the Intel AnyPoint DSL Gateway (Model 1400), open a browser and navigate to 192.168.0.254. Enter the default username "admin" and password "admin". If these credentials do not work, the password may have been changed — use the reset button to restore factory defaults.

How Do I Log In to the Intel AnyPoint DSL Gateway (Model 1400) Router Admin Panel?

To access the Intel AnyPoint DSL Gateway (Model 1400) admin panel (router configuration interface), follow these steps:
  1. Connect Your Device: Ensure your computer or laptop is connected to the Intel AnyPoint DSL Gateway (Model 1400) router, preferably via an Ethernet cable to prevent connection loss during setup.
  2. Open a Web Browser: Launch your preferred web browser (such as Google Chrome, Mozilla Firefox, Microsoft Edge, or Safari) on the connected device.
  3. Enter the IP Address: In the address bar of your web browser, type the default IP address for the Intel AnyPoint DSL Gateway (Model 1400), which is 192.168.0.254, and then press Enter.
  4. Enter Credentials: On the login page that appears, enter the default username "admin" and the default password "admin" in the respective fields.
  5. Access Admin Panel: Click the "Login" or "Submit" button to access the router's administrative interface. From here, you can configure your network settings.
Using a wired Ethernet connection is strongly recommended for initial configuration to avoid disconnections that could interrupt the setup process. How Do I Find the Intel AnyPoint DSL Gateway (Model 1400) Login IP Address?

The default IP address for the Intel AnyPoint DSL Gateway (Model 1400) is 192.168.0.254. This is the address you will type into your web browser to access the router's settings. If you are unsure of the IP address, it is often printed on a label on the back or bottom of the router itself. In cases where the default IP might have been changed or is not working, you can find your router's current IP address by checking your device's network settings. For Windows users, you can open the Command Prompt and type ipconfig. Look for the "Default Gateway" entry under your active network connection; this is your router's IP address. For macOS or Linux users, open the Terminal and type ip route | grep default or check your network preferences. The most common default IP addresses for routers are 192.168.1.1 and 192.168.0.1, but for this specific Intel model, 192.168.0.254 is the designated address. If you are trying to access the router and 192.168.0.254 isn't working, verify it's the correct IP for your network.

How Do I Reset the Intel AnyPoint DSL Gateway (Model 1400) Router Password Without Logging In?

You can reset the Intel AnyPoint DSL Gateway (Model 1400) to factory defaults without knowing the current password by using the hardware reset button. This process will revert all settings, including your Wi-Fi name and password, back to their original factory configurations. Here are the steps to perform a hard reset:
  1. Locate the Reset Button: Find the small, often recessed, reset button on the back or bottom of your Intel AnyPoint DSL Gateway (Model 1400) router. You may need a paperclip or a similar pointed object to press it.
  2. Power On the Router: Ensure the router is powered on and connected to power.
  3. Press and Hold: With the router powered on, press and hold the reset button for approximately 10 seconds. You might see the indicator lights on the router flash or change, indicating the reset process has begun.
  4. Release the Button: Release the reset button.
  5. Wait for Reboot: The router will now reboot with its factory default settings. This process can take a few minutes.
After the router restarts, you will need to use the default login credentials (admin/admin) and reconfigure your network settings, including your Wi-Fi network name (SSID) and password. This method is effective for resetting a router password without login access.

Why Can't I Log In to My Intel AnyPoint DSL Gateway (Model 1400) Router?

Several common issues can prevent you from logging into your Intel AnyPoint DSL Gateway (Model 1400) router. The most frequent reasons include using the wrong IP address, having entered incorrect credentials, or attempting to log in with a changed password. If the default username "admin" and password "admin" are not working, it is highly probable that the password has been modified from its default setting. Other potential causes include ensuring your device is correctly connected to the router's network, either via Wi-Fi or Ethernet cable. If you are using Wi-Fi, confirm you are connected to the Intel AnyPoint DSL Gateway (Model 1400)'s network. Sometimes, clearing your web browser's cache and cookies can resolve login page loading issues. Firewall settings on your computer or network could also block access to the router's admin interface. If all else fails, a factory reset of the router is the most reliable way to regain access using the default credentials.

How Do I Secure My Intel AnyPoint DSL Gateway (Model 1400) Router After Login?

Securing your Intel AnyPoint DSL Gateway (Model 1400) router after logging in is crucial for protecting your network from unauthorized access. The first and most important step is to change the default password from "admin" to a strong, unique password. A strong password should be at least 12 characters long and include a mix of uppercase and lowercase letters, numbers, and symbols. You should also change the default Wi-Fi network name (SSID) to something that does not identify the router model or your location. Enable WPA2 or WPA3 encryption for your Wi-Fi network; WPA3 offers superior security. If your router supports it, consider disabling WPS (Wi-Fi Protected Setup) as it can be a security vulnerability. Regularly check for firmware updates from Intel, if available, and apply them promptly, as these updates often include security patches. Disabling remote management, which allows access to the router's settings from outside your home network, is also a recommended security practice unless specifically needed.
